Name   vicR   Type   Regulator
Locus tag   FQT67_RS02840 Genome accession   NZ_LR595857
Coordinates   528653..529363 (+) Length   236 a.a.
NCBI ID   WP_003049952.1    Uniprot ID   A0A9X9SIG1
Organism   Streptococcus sp. NCTC 11567 strain NCTC11567     
Function   repress comCDE expression; repress comX expression (predicted from homology)
